What is a Chromebook Kit?
A Chromebook Kit consists of 1 Chromebook laptop, 1 hot spot, and 1 computer mouse to provide you with Wi-Fi and computer access from home.
How to Use a Chromebook?
To use a Chromebook:
- Power on the Chromebook by clicking the power button on the upper right-hand corner of the keyboard
- Log-in by clicking the arrow under the username “Public Chromebook”
- Move through the next screen by clicking the blue arrow
- Click “Accept and Continue” after reading through the noblenet.org Terms of Service
- Google Chrome will automatically launch and is ready to use
How to Use a Hot Spot
- Turn on the Library Hot spot and Chromebook.
- Go into the network setting/WiFi setup area in the right-hand corner of the Chromebook menu.
- Find the name of the Hot spot you are trying to connect to. The name of the hot spot is located within a Kit’s enclosed instructions.
- Enter the hot spot password to connect. The password is listed within the Kit’s instructions.
- Begin using your Chrombook!
Hot spots are portable once the battery is charged and only require recharging every few hours (duration of battery life varies depending on service signal strength, number of devices connected, etc.). Hot spots can be used in your home, in a car, or anywhere service is available.
Our Hot spots are from Mobile Beacon. Mobile Beacon’s internet service is provided on Sprint’s 4G LTE network. Check Sprint’s 4G LTE coverage.
How can I borrow one?
Lynnfield Public Library Chromebook Kit Procedure – pdf print verison
Patrons may place a Chromebook Kit on hold for pickup at Lynnfield Library only. Chromebook Kits must be picked up and returned to the Lynnfield Public Library. One Chromebook Kit may be borrowed per library card.
Chromebook Kits can be checked out for two weeks with no renewals.
All parts of the Chromebook Kit must be returned in the case; the Kit will remain checked out to the patron and fines will accrue until all parts are returned. Replacement Chromebooks, or replacements of the accompanying parts of the Kit, will not be accepted. Patrons are responsible for damage to or loss of Chromebooks and accessories as a result of accident, theft, misuse or neglect; the approximate replacement cost of a Kit is $400.00. Additionally, patrons are expected to report loss or damage to the Chromebook or accessories to Circulation Desk staff.
Overdue Chromebook Kits will accrue fines at $5 per day until returned, or the maximum fines of $25 are reached, and will be deactivated within 48 hours after the due date.
